Handel - Messiah - Northampton Cathedral

I returned to Northampton Cathedral on Friday 20th December 2019 to play first trumpet in ‘Mr. Handel’s Messiah’ with the choir and orchestra of Fiori Musicali, under the direction of Penelope Rapson. Katy Hill (soprano), Robert Cross (countertenor), Edmund Hastings (tenor) and James Birchall (Bass) were the soloists for this year’s performance, and I played The Trumpet Shall Sound with James Birchall.

After performances in Luxembourg and Budapest on Wednesday and Thursday, I returned to the United Kingdom early on Friday morning, quickly calling at home to collect my tails before heading to Northampton for the Fiori Musicali rehearsal and concert, which has traditionally marked the end of one of the busiest seasons of the year.
